Journey to the Sun ( Turkish Güneşe Yolculuk ) is a film by Yeşim Ustaoğlu and tells about the friendship between the Turk Mehmet and the Kurd Berzan. The film is a Turkish-Dutch-German coproduction.

action

The main character of the film is the young Turk Mehmet Kara, who comes from Tire in İzmir and has lived in Istanbul for a few months . He works with his teacher, Süleyman Bey, at the waterworks, tracks down broken water pipes and is friends with Arzu.

One night he met Berzan during a fight with hooligans . Berzan is a Kurd who had to leave his village of Zorduç because of a flooding by a reservoir and who has been a hawker in Istanbul for two years. The two become friends.

During a bus ride, Mehmet ran into a police checkpoint and was arrested when a pistol was found on the bus that was left by another passenger. Mehmet is suspected of being a terrorist. The officers also find a Kurdish music cassette - a gift from Berzan - and because of his dark skin color do not believe that he is a Turk from İzmir.

After his release, Mehmet loses his job and apartment and starts looking for Berzan. After he finds him, he moves in with him and works with him in various jobs. He found a golden spray can on a heap of rubbish to lighten his hair so that one would mistake him for a Turk.

Berzan is captured during a demonstration and later murdered. Mehmet makes it his business to bring his body to Berzan's home village near the Iraqi border and to bury it there. With a stolen pickup truck, he travels across the country with the coffin and sees the situation of the people in the east of the country. In Hasankeyf's home, for example, he sees a family who are leaving their home to move to Istanbul, or three little boys who distribute PKK newspapers . On his journey he sees many empty and destroyed houses, the doors of which are marked with a red X. He also noticed the large military presence with many roadside checks and curfews.

Mehmet travels part of the way by train and meets a conscript who is on his way to the barracks. When they ask each other about their hometown, the conscript says that he is from Tire. But Mehmet says that he comes from Zorduç and that he has a friend named Mehmet Kara in Tire. When he arrives in Zorduç, he slides the coffin into the reservoir.

Reviews

The Nürnberger Zeitung wrote:

"She bravely and relentlessly puts her finger in the wound, showing the most depressing conditions with gloomy realism: a topography of terror, fear and misery in Turkey, in which people and culture, landscape and history are abandoned to destruction."

www.kino.de wrote:

“The Turkish-Dutch-German coproduction, which was awarded at the Berlinale, tells of friendship and moral courage. In beautiful pictures by Jacek Petrychi, Krzysztof Kieslowski's cameraman, director Yesim Ustaoglu presents not only a socially engaged, but also a poetic and touching portrait of Turkey. "

After the award ceremony at the 49th Berlinale, Yeşim Ustaoğlu said:

“The system dictates and defines how people should live, I wanted to defend myself against that. The conflicts in the world do not affect all directly. As a result, the unaffected usually do not care much about these problems. When you walk through the streets, just look straight ahead and don't look down at the puddle on the sidewalk, which may reflect other sides of life. In Günese Yolculuk you can see that this all too often overlooked other life takes place right around the corner. "

Trivia

  • The film title is based on the international union song "Brothers, to the Sun, to Freedom!" ajar.
  • After returning to Turkey from the Berlinale, some of the actors were arrested. The film won many awards in Turkey
  • The main actors Nazmi Kırık, Newroz Baz and Mizgin Kapazan are amateur actors.
